How it's calculated

Convert miles per US gallon to liters per 100 km— the formula

Fuel consumption is reciprocal — more fuel used per distance means lower miles per US gallon and higher L/100km. The conversion goes through L/100km as a canonical form.

L/100km = 235.214583 ÷ mpg

Reciprocal relationship (more fuel = lower mpg = higher L/100km). US mpg ↔ L/100km via 235.214583 = (3.785411784 L/gal × 100 / 1.609344 km/mi). km/L = 100 / L/100km.

Frequently asked questions

  • Is higher mpg better or worse?

    Higher mpg is better — your car covers more miles per gallon of fuel. Lower L/100km is better for the same reason (less fuel used per 100 km driven).
  • Why is the conversion reciprocal instead of linear?

    Because the units encode fuel consumption from opposite directions. mpg measures "distance per unit of fuel" (more is better); L/100km measures "fuel per unit of distance" (less is better). The two are mathematically inversely related, so the conversion is a division, not a multiplication.
  • Are US and UK gallons the same in mpg calculations?

    No — this calculator uses US gallons (1 US gal = 3.785411784 L). A car rated 30 US mpg is rated about 36 UK mpg (1 imperial gal = 4.54609 L). If you need imperial mpg, multiply US mpg by 1.20095.
